Mime

Тема в разделе "Lotus - Программирование", создана пользователем NickProstoNick, 10 окт 2012.

  1. NickProstoNick

    NickProstoNick Статус как статус :)

    Регистрация:
    22 авг 2008
    Сообщения:
    1.766
    Симпатии:
    39
    Всем привет!
    Есть вопрос... не знаю как победить.
    В MIME пишу ссылку на картинку в формате <img src="http://<сервер>/<база>/<документ>/<картинка>" /> - работает
    Попробовал в формате <img src="/<база>/<документ>/<картинка>" /> - не работает, но надо бы чтоб работало.
    Не хочется привязываться к серверу. Может я что-то пропустил?

    Исходная база и база с картинками в разных директориях на одном сервере
    Это все в клиенте Lotus Notes

    В общем суть задачи - отобразить картинку без загрузки ее в документ.
     
  2. savl

    savl Lotus team
    Lotus team

    Регистрация:
    28 окт 2011
    Сообщения:
    2.052
    Симпатии:
    146
    вряд ли так можно, сервер/хост все равно нужен, чтобы знать откуда ее брать.
     
  3. NickProstoNick

    NickProstoNick Статус как статус :)

    Регистрация:
    22 авг 2008
    Сообщения:
    1.766
    Симпатии:
    39
    Ну то такое.
    Сейчас больше волнует размер изображения
    Такое клиент лотуса не воспринимает. Размер изображения остается 100% :(
    Код (Text):
    <img src="images/sample.gif" width="50%" height="50%">
    И проблема с кирилистическими названиями файлов :(
     
  4. lmike

    lmike нет, пердело совершенство
    Команда форума Lotus team

    Регистрация:
    27 авг 2008
    Сообщения:
    6.082
    Симпатии:
    300
    кириллически названия - urlencode нужен
    для маймов есть cid, но это встроенный имэдж
    майм он для интернет :( (что отражено в названии) если нотусня не хочет соответствовать стандартам - дык то вина ибм
    можно пробовать подсовывать url вида notes:// а вот с "вычислением" (вернее - его в рантайм не сунешь) имени сервера - да, засада будет
     
  5. duchan

    duchan Well-Known Member

    Регистрация:
    20 сен 2006
    Сообщения:
    106
    Симпатии:
    3
    протокол notes:// не поддерживает получение вложений и ресурсов из базы, т.е. когда Вы пишите "<img src="/<база>/<документ>/<картинка>" />" то в клиенте лотуса применяется не http, а notes протокол, и Вы не сможете получить вложенную картинку или картинку из ресурса. НО, замечательно поддерживается протокол file://..... так что можно картинку деаттачить в темповую папку на комп и в src прописать url до этой картинки <img src="с|/temp/myimage.gif" /> (temp на винде можно получить через Environ)
     
  6. NickProstoNick

    NickProstoNick Статус как статус :)

    Регистрация:
    22 авг 2008
    Сообщения:
    1.766
    Симпатии:
    39
    Это <img src="/<база>/<документ>/<картинка>" /> через MIME в Notes-клиенте работает.
    И Бог с ними с вычислениями сервера...то мелочи.
    Осталась проблема с размерами картинки... ну то такое.
     
  7. lmike

    lmike нет, пердело совершенство
    Команда форума Lotus team

    Регистрация:
    27 авг 2008
    Сообщения:
    6.082
    Симпатии:
    300
    а в др. "браузерах" этот майм как отображается (ресайзит?)
     
  8. NickProstoNick

    NickProstoNick Статус как статус :)

    Регистрация:
    22 авг 2008
    Сообщения:
    1.766
    Симпатии:
    39
    Не проверял... но вопрос решил.... сделал миниатюру изображения
     
Загрузка...
Похожие Темы - Mime
  1. Amfion
    Ответов:
    0
    Просмотров:
    446
  2. Amfion
    Ответов:
    5
    Просмотров:
    768
  3. YGol
    Ответов:
    4
    Просмотров:
    1.192
  4. seoman2
    Ответов:
    13
    Просмотров:
    1.822
  5. Мыш
    Ответов:
    2
    Просмотров:
    1.187

Поделиться этой страницей